Abstract
The invention discloses a multifunctional portable backup power automatic switching test device. According to the multifunctional portable backup power automatic switching test device, a line voltage transformer I (7) and a line circuit breaker I (5) of a line I (1) are connected in series to form a branch I; a busbar I (4) is connected with a busbar voltage transformer I (6) and a branch I; a line voltage transformer II (11) and a line circuit breaker II (9) of a line II (2) are connected in series to form a branch II; a busbar II (8) is connected with a busbar voltage transformer II (10) and the branch II; a busbar circuit breaker (3) is arranged between the busbar I (4) and the busbar II (8); the voltage input end of the busbar I (4) is connected with a voltage control switch I (12); and the voltage input end of the busbar II (8) is connected with a voltage control switch II (13).

Background technology
In integrated automation of transformation stations transformation process, after automatic change-over device of emergency (abbreviation backup auto-activating device) replacing of various electric pressure, backup auto-activating device function debugging need be carried out.Each isolating switch of participation prepared auto restart logic is usually all or part of coordinates debugging because power supply needs can not have a power failure for a long time, simulating each circuit-breaker status manually, to change not only process loaded down with trivial details, and normal because each circuit-breaker status handoff procedure and actuation time coordinating bad with device logic, cause success of the test rate low and process of the test, result are not directly perceived.

The present invention carries out test connection according to the requirement of backup auto-activating device.Select correct mimic-disconnecting switch contact (break contact or moving together contact) access device, the standby line voltage distribution from device of input and busbar voltage are by voltage cut-out I 12 of the present invention and voltage cut-out II 13.
Experimentation of the present invention is: 1, when circuit backup power automatic switching mode: circuit I 1 makes main power supply, and circuit II 2 makes available power supply, and line-breaker I 5, bus 3 are at closing position, and line-breaker II 9 is at open position.Circuit I 1, circuit II 2, bus I 4 and bus II 8 voltage detecting are normal, check that backup auto-activating device charging is normal, now cut off voltage cut-out I 12 and voltage cut-out II 13 simultaneously, bus I 4 and bus II 8 dead electricity, backup auto-activating device is by first tripping line-breaker I 5 actuation time of setting, close line-breaker II 9 again, recovers bus I 4 and bus II 8 power supply.In like manner, circuit II 2 makes main power supply, and circuit I 1 makes available power supply, and line-breaker II 9, bus 3 are at closing position, and line-breaker I 5 is at open position.Circuit I 1 and circuit II 2, bus I 4 and bus II 8 voltage detecting normal, check that backup auto-activating device charging is normal, the now simultaneously voltage cut-out I 12 of cutting-off controlling bus I 4 and bus II 8 voltage and voltage cut-out II 13, bus I 4 and bus II 8 dead electricity, backup auto-activating device is by first tripping line-breaker II 9 actuation time of setting, close line-breaker I 5 again, recovers bus I 4 and bus II 8 power supply.
2, mother prepared auto restart mode: line-breaker I 5, line-breaker II 9 are at closing position, and bus 3 is at open position.Circuit I 1 and circuit II 2, bus I 4 and bus II 8 voltage detecting normal, check that backup auto-activating device charging is normal, the now voltage cut-out I 12 of cutting-off controlling bus I 4, bus I 4 dead electricity, backup auto-activating device is by first tripping line-breaker I 5 actuation time of setting, close bus 3 again, recovers bus I 4 and power.In like manner, line-breaker I 5, line-breaker II 9 are at closing position, and bus 3 is at open position.Circuit I 1 and circuit II 2, bus I 4 and bus II 8 voltage detecting normal, check that backup auto-activating device charging is normal, now cutting-off controlling voltage cut-out II 13, bus II 8 dead electricity, backup auto-activating device is by first tripping line-breaker II 9 actuation time of setting, close bus 3 again, recovers bus II 8 and power.
